KOMPARASI MODEL-VIEW-CONTROLLER (MVC) VS. MODEL-VIEW-PRESENTER (MVP) PADA WAKTU EKSEKUSI DAN PENGGUNAAN MEMORI Yohannis, Alfa Ryano; Ong, Alexander Dennis; Ghazali, Arnold Christopher; Devisepte, Okhama Siladata; Christian, Brandon Josua; Chudra, Glenny; Siregar, Master Edison

Abstract

Pilihan pola arsitektur secara signifikan mempengaruhi kinerja dan efisiensi memori sistem perangkat lunak. Makalah ini menyajikan analisis komparatif antara dua pola arsitektur yang banyak digunakan: Model-View-Controller (MVC) dan Model-View-Presenter (MVP). Kajian pada makalah ini bertujuan memberikan wawasan mengenai pola arsitektur mana yang lebih unggul dalam hal kecepatan komputasi dan penggunaan memori, faktor-faktor penting dalam menentukan skalabilitas dan responsivitas aplikasi. Untuk melakukan evaluasi yang adil, kajian ini mengimplementasikan aplikasi identik menggunakan arsitektur MVC dan MVP. Kajian mengukur kecepatan eksekusi dan jejak memori dari masing-masing pola dalam berbagai skenario input yang berbeda. Dengan memberikan bukti empiris mengenai atribut kinerja MVC dan MVP, studi ini diharapkan dapat berkontribusi pada pengambilan keputusan yang lebih terinformasi dalam perancangan arsitektur, yang pada akhirnya meningkatkan kualitas dan efisiensi keseluruhan sistem perangkat lunak.
Leveraging Enterprise Architecture to Empower KOMINFO's Business Core Operations: A PMO Perspective Purawidjaja, Ratna Amalia; Chudra, Glenny; Indrajit, Eko; Dazki, Erick; Yohannis, Alfa

Abstract

The Sky Bridge (Tol Langit) Program is an Indonesian government’s strategic project aimed at digital transformation in the 3T regions (Tertinggal, Terdepan, Terluar - Underdeveloped, Frontline, Outermost). It requires thorough planning and integrated management for its implementation. A specialized unit with a helicopter view perspective is needed to ensure and oversee the alignment of processes. This important role is managed by the Project Management Office (PMO). One of the challenges PMO faces in ensuring an end-to-end process alignment is identifying the appropriate digital resources to support the process. This is where the Enterprise Architecture (EA) framework plays a crucial role as a blueprint for the organization's digital landscape. This reference helps map out existing data, applications, and business processes. Having this blueprint allows PMO to have a holistic view and make targeted decisions. EA also helps identify existing applications that can be integrated with new programs, avoiding unnecessary duplication. The use of ArchiMate, a language for enterprise architecture modeling, assists PMOs in planning digital transformations considering all aspects - business needs, applications, and technology. In short, a well-defined EA framework empowers PMOs to navigate the complexities of digital transformation in the telecommunications sector to ensure the successful implementation of the Sky Bridge Program.
Comprehensive Study of Information Technology Strategy Components in Global ICT Companies Utilizing PESTLE and Ansoff Matrix Purawidjaja, Ratna Amalia; Chudra, Glenny; Yohannis, Alfa

Abstract

This research underscores the diversity and strategic significance of IT Strategy components in shaping the digital transformation and competitive edge of ICT companies. The formulation of IT Strategy documents is pivotal for industries, including ICT companies, as it ensures alignment with business goals and competitive positioning. This study conducts a comprehensive literature review of IT Strategy components within global ICT companies, specifically those specializing in telecommunication network infrastructure. Despite operating within the same sector, each company’s IT Strategy document comprises distinct components. The identified components include Auditor Report, Business Strategy, Leadership, Product/Service Line, Geographic Performance, Research & Development, Partnership & Acquisition, Summary Report, Corporate Governance, Vision & Mission, Financial Statement, Industry Trends, and Business Highlights.  These components are essential for aiding the organization’s IT Strategic Plan and the creation of the company's roadmap. Furthermore, this study identifies PESTLE analysis and the Ansoff Matrix as crucial tools in creating strategic roadmaps tailored to each company’s unique objectives and market conditions.
Designing a Company Risk Register and Risk Monitoring System to Assist in Managing Aircraft MRO Risks Dhamayanti, Raditia; Chudra, Glenny; Yohannis, Alfa

Abstract

This company specializes in maintenance, repair, and overhaul (MRO) services for aircraft. MRO activities are crucial to ensuring the safety and reliability of aircraft operations. However, these activities also involve various risks that can affect the performance and reputation of companies in multiple fields. To manage these risks effectively, a system for risk registration and monitoring has been designed for companies in the MRO industry. This paper presents the design of the Risk Register and Monitoring System, which includes the identification, assessment, and management of risks related to the activities of all existing units within companies in the MRO industry. This system is designed to provide a structured approach to risk management, which can help companies in the MRO industry manage risks across all units. The proposed system consists of several components, including automation for performing risk registers and monitoring through a website. This system allows companies in the MRO industry to assess the severity of risks, simplify risk management strategies, and streamline the risk registration process. As a result, companies in the MRO industry can minimize the impact of risks from each unit and enhance efficiency and effectiveness in risk management

Enterprise Architecture for the Cruise Industry: A TOGAF-ADM and ArchiMate-Based Approach Watasendjaja, William; Chudra, Glenny; Yohannis, Alfa

Abstract

Despite its growth and resilience over the last decades, the cruise industry faces significant challenges in its strategic, operational, and technology domains. The unique complexity of the industry requires cruise companies to adopt a structured approach to enterprise transformation. To address this problem, this aims to provide an Enterprise Architecture (EA) blueprint for the cruise industry. Using a case study of a leading cruise line, CruiseX, this study analyzes the operational model of the cruise line and apply two industry-leading standards: The Open Group Architecture Framework (TOGAF) and the ArchiMate modelling language. This study applies the four core phases of TOGAF Architecture Development Method (ADM) from the initial phase of Architecture Vision (Phase A), through the definition of Business Architecture, Information System Architecture, and Technology Architecture (Phase B to D). The ArchiMate language is utilized to visualize the core business processes, information systems, and technology architecture. By using TOGAF ADM as the technical guidelines and ArchiMate as the modeling language, the result of this study is a blueprint of core business processes, application and data that support each business processes, and the underlying technology infrastructure, that provides a structured framework and serves as an actionable tool for implementing enterprise architecture in cruise industry. This research also extends the application of TOGAF and ArchiMate to the under-research cruise industry domain. The study’s limitations include the reliance on publicly available data, the limited scope of business processes, and the lacks of practitioner validation, suggesting clear directions for future research.

Pengembangan Aplikasi Monitoring Tambak Ikan Berbasis Internet of Things Dhamayanti, Raditia; Chudra, Glenny; Yohannis, Alfa

Abstract

Milkfish is the largest freshwater fish commodity in Indonesia. Milkfish farming requires extra care and maintenance because these fish are sensitive to the environment, which can affect the growth and quality of fish. One important factor that affects milkfish growth is pond water quality, which can be measured through indicators such as temperature, oxygen levels, and water acidity. Today, water quality measurements are still traditionally done by coming directly to the pool, which requires additional time and effort. The purpose of this research is to develop e-chan as an Internet of Things-based innovation tool. The development of e-Chan is made using the SDLC (Software Development Lifecycle) method. The results showed the designed tool could be used to monitor pond water quality in real-time and transmit data to users through the app. Ikan bandeng merupakan komoditas ikan air tawar terbesar di Indonesia. Budidaya bandeng membutuhkan perawatan dan pemeliharaan yang ekstra karena ikan ini peka terhadap lingkungan yang dapat mempengaruhi pertumbuhan dan kualitas ikan. Satu faktor penting yang mempengaruhi pertumbuhan ikan bandeng adalah kualitas air tambak, yang dapat diukur melalui indikator seperti suhu, kadar oksigen, dan keasaman air. Saat ini, pengukuran kualitas air umumnya masih dilakukan secara tradisional dengan datang langsung ke kolam, yang membutuhkan waktu dan tenaga tambahan. Tujuan penelitian ini adalah mengembangkan e-chan sebagai alat inovasi berbasis Internet of Things. Pengembangan e-Chan dibuat dengan menggunakan metode SDLC (Software Development Lifecycle). Hasil penelitian menunjukkan alat yang dirancang dapat digunakan untuk memantau kualitas air tambak secara real-time dan mengirimkan data kepada pengguna melalui aplikasi.
